Teacher’s Creative Thinking Skills (TCTS): Development and Validation of a Scale for Secondary School Teachers

Abstract:
The study aimed to develop a Teacher's Creative Thinking Scale (TCTS) to assess the creative thinking skills of secondary school teachers. The 52-item measure is broken down into six dimensions: fluency, flexibility, originality, curiosity, elaboration and boldness. The test's content, face, and construct validity were evaluated through expert judgments and factor analysis. After receiving expert feedback, 11 items were removed from the initial draft of 51 items. The first sample was randomly selected from 105 secondary school teachers in Uttar Pradesh, India. After completing the first try-out, 35 items were finalized. The researchers administered the scale to 225 teachers. As a result of EFA, 11 items were omitted, and CFA confirmed a scale of 24 items. The optimistic results of this study indicate that the scale is valid and reliable for secondary school teachers.
